News Summary

Join healthcare professionals at the upcoming Neurosciences Symposium hosted by Ballad Health in Johnson City on March 4, 2025. Starting at 7 a.m. and concluding by 3:30 p.m., this full-day event will feature expert discussions on vital topics including stroke treatment and traumatic brain injury. Registration is $30 and includes meals, providing an excellent opportunity for networking and knowledge sharing among physicians, nurses, and other healthcare practitioners. Exciting Neurosciences Symposium Coming to Johnson City!

Hey there, folks of Johnson City! Mark your calendars for a fantastic opportunity to enhance your knowledge in the fascinating field of neurosciences. Ballad Health is hosting a Neurosciences Symposium on Friday, March 4, 2025, and you won’t want to miss it!

When and Where?

The event kicks off bright and early at 7 a.m. and wraps up around 3:30 p.m., making it a full day packed with valuable insights and discussions. Gather at the James and Nellie Brinkley Center, formerly known as the Millennium Centre, right here in Johnson City, TN. This venue will be buzzing with excitement as healthcare professionals come together to learn and share knowledge!

What’s on the Agenda?

The symposium has an impressive lineup of experts who will cover a range of crucial topics. Think about some of the most pressing issues in neurosciences, like stroke treatment, interventional radiology, traumatic brain injury, and epilepsy. These discussions are not just interesting; they are essential, as they directly relate to the management of patients dealing with neuroscience disorders.

This is a prime opportunity for those in the healthcare profession to gain a comprehensive review of best practices. With the ever-evolving nature of medical science, staying updated is not just beneficial—it’s necessary. Specifically, the goal here is to arm you with the latest knowledge and skills you need to provide top-notch care to your patients.

Who Should Attend?

Are you a physician, nurse practitioner, physician assistant, or any other healthcare professional with a focus on neurosciences? Then this symposium is tailored just for you! The event is designed to create an enlightening environment where professionals can learn from one another and enhance their skills.

A Collaborative Effort

The hard work behind this symposium is the brainchild of the Ballad Health stroke coordinators, who have organized an event that is not just educational but also empowering. It’s a chance to connect with colleagues, share experiences, and walk away with practical strategies that can make a difference in your practice.

Registration Details

Thinking of joining this enriching experience? The good news—registration is super simple! You can sign up online, and it’s just $30 per person. That’s a small price to pay for a wealth of knowledge and the opportunity to network with fellow professionals. Plus, when you attend, you’ll enjoy lunch and snacks provided for all participants!
